As a model organism Most commonly used plant model
Like the fruit flies of the plant world Advantages:
Small size - Max 5cm in diameter, 30cm tall Easy to cultivate - grown in small area Small genome (5 chromosomes, 157 million base pairs,
27,000 genes) Rapid development - about 6 weeks to make mature seed Can self-pollinate Can perform crosses between different strains Many progeny Easy to perform genetic engineering
Can be transformed using Agrobacterium tumefaciens
